mail, finger, and rsh/rexec as well as by guessing weak pass- words. Before spreading to a new machine, the Morris Worm checked if the machine had already been infected and was running a Morris Worm process.
A bug in his code infected sys-
tems throughout the internet at a faster pace than Morris originally ex- pected, and his worm ended up infecting an estimated 10 per- cent of the internet. The end result was major damage and widespread outages. This term is also known as the great worm or the inter- net worm.
